PORTLAND, OR , Dec. 11, 2012 (RISI) -
Canadian housing starts in November were a seasonally adjusted annual rate (SAAR) of 196,125 units, down from 203,487 in October, according to the Canadian Mortgage and Housing Corporation.
The SAAR of urban starts decreased by 4.0% to 174,323 units in November. Urban single starts declined by 5.4% to 58,606, while urban multiple starts fell by 3.2% to 115,717 units.
